Could You Qualify for an Energy-Efficient Tax Deduction?
Section 179D of the tax code allows a deduction for the cost of energy-efficient improvements to new or existing commercial buildings, as well as certain residential rental buildings. This article explains how construction companies might be able to qualify for the deduction, even though the tax break is primarily intended for property owners. 

Adding Value With Life-Cycle Cost Analysis
Life-cycle cost analysis (LCCA) seeks to estimate a construction project’s overall cost of ownership over its “useful life cycle.” It then strives to identify design or construction alternatives that will minimize costs over that life cycle. This article explains how contractors can play a role in LCCA and, in doing so, give themselves a competitive edge.

Businesses Will Soon Be Able To Deduct More Under the Standard Mileage Rate
Contractors may be tired of the rising gas prices and how they are affecting their business. Thankfully, as prices hit a record high, nearly $2.00 higher than a year ago, the IRS is providing some relief. The agency has announced an increase in the optional standard mileage rate for the last six months of 2022.
